"Multiple Injuries Reported in Shooting at Kansas City Chiefs Super Bowl Parade Celebration"

TL;DR Summary
One person has died and at least 14 others were injured in a shooting at the end of the rally celebrating the Kansas City Chiefs' Super Bowl win, with the area being steps away from where the victory rally for thousands of fans took place. The shooting disrupted what had been a raucous day of celebration for Chiefs fans, with an estimated 1 million people in downtown Kansas City. Two armed individuals were taken into custody, and the shooting is the latest instance of gun violence disrupting American life at places once considered safe.
